Mélanie Laurent: Her Life and Early Days
Mélanie Laurent came into the world on February 21, 1983, in the city of Paris, France. That date, you know, means she recently turned 41, which is a pretty interesting age for someone with so much creative work already done. Her upbringing, it seems, was in the 9th arrondissement of Paris, a part of the city that has its own unique feel. Her family background, as a matter of fact, is quite artistic, which might have played a role in her own creative leanings from a young age.
She has a mother, Annick, who taught ballet, so there was, like, a connection to expressive movement and performance in her home. Her father, Pierre, was a voice actor, someone who used his voice to bring characters to life. He is, in fact, very well known for being the voice of a character in the French version of a very popular animated show that started back in 1989, which is pretty cool if you think about it. This kind of environment, with parents involved in different forms of performance, naturally, could have sparked her interest in the arts early on.
There is also a younger brother in the family, Mathieu. The family's heritage, too, is quite rich and diverse. Mélanie Laurent has roots that trace back to both Sephardi Jewish people from Tunisia and Ashkenazi Jewish people from Poland. Personal Details and Bio Data of Mélanie Laurent
Full Name | Mélanie Laurent |
Date of Birth | February 21, 1983 |
Place of Birth | Paris, France |
Current Age | 41 (as of February 2024) |
Nationality | French |
Occupations | Actress, Director, Screenwriter, Singer |
Parents | Annick (Ballet Teacher), Pierre (Voice Actor) |
Sibling | Mathieu (Younger Brother) |
Ancestry | Sephardi Jewish (Tunisia) and Ashkenazi Jewish (Poland) |
Notable Awards | Two César Awards, Lumière Award |

Mélanie Laurent on the Big Screen: Memorable Appearances
When it comes to her acting work, Mélanie Laurent has appeared in a lot of films that have left a mark, both in France and, you know, across the globe. She has a knack for choosing roles that are, in some respects, quite varied, showing her ability to adapt to different kinds of stories and characters. Her performances have, in fact, been a key part of some very well-known movies, making her a familiar face to many cinema lovers.
One of the roles that brought her a lot of international attention was in a film from 2009 called Inglourious Basterds. That movie, you know, was a big deal, and her part in it really helped introduce her to audiences outside of France. People everywhere, like, got to see her talent on a much larger scale. Then, a few years later, in 2013, she was in Now You See Me, which was another film that reached a wide audience and, honestly, showcased her ability to be part of a big ensemble cast.
She has also been in more recent international productions, such as Operation Finale in 2018 and 6 Underground in 2019. These roles, too, cemented her status as someone who can work effectively in big-budget, globally distributed movies. But it is not just about the big Hollywood productions; she has a rich history in French cinema as well, with films like Don't Worry, I'm Fine, which, you know, earned her significant recognition in her home country. How Did Mélanie Laurent Get Her Start in Acting?
It is always interesting to hear how someone begins their creative path, and Mélanie Laurent's story is, in a way, pretty unique. She started acting when she was just sixteen years old, which is, you know, quite young to be stepping into such a demanding profession. Her entry into the acting world came about in a rather direct manner, thanks to a chance meeting that, actually, changed her life's direction.
The story goes that in 1998, she was visiting a film set, just, like, observing what was happening. It was there that she caught the eye of Gérard Depardieu, a very well-known French actor. He, apparently, saw something in her, some spark or natural talent, and decided to cast her in a film. That movie was called Un pont entre deux rives, which translates to The Bridge. This unexpected opportunity, you know, basically opened the door for her, giving her a first real taste of what it was like to be part of a film production.
From that initial role, her career began to take shape. She started getting more parts, slowly building up her experience and showing what she could do. What Awards Has Mélanie Laurent Received?
Recognition for one's work is always a special thing, and Mélanie Laurent has, in fact, received some very important honors for her contributions to cinema. These awards, you know, are a testament to the quality and impact of her performances and her creative efforts. They show that her peers and critics alike have acknowledged her talent and the significant mark she has made in the film industry.
She has been honored with two César Awards, which are, essentially, the national film awards of France, much like the Academy Awards in the United States. Winning even one César is a big achievement, so getting two really highlights her standing in French cinema. One of these, for instance, was the César for Best Female Newcomer in 2007, which she received for her work in the film Je vais bien, ne t'en fais pas, also known as I'm Fine, Don't Worry. This early recognition, too, signaled that she was a rising talent with a lot of promise.
In addition to the César Awards, she has also been given a Lumière Award. The Lumière Awards, like, also celebrate excellence in French cinema, and receiving one further emphasizes her respected position within the industry.
